Question: The moment of inertia of a body rotating about a given axis is $ 6.0kgm^{2} $ in the SI system. What is the value of the moment of inertia in a system of units in which the unit of length is 5 cm and the unit of mass is 10 g?

Options:

A) $ 2.4\times 10^{3} $

B) $ 2.4\times 10^{5} $

C) $ 6.0\times 10^{3} $

D) $ 6.0\times 10^{5} $

Show Answer

Answer:

Correct Answer: B

Solution:

[b] In new system, $ 1g*=10g,1cm*=5cm. $

$ I=6\times 100\times g*{{(20cm*)}^{2}}=6\times 100\times 400g\times cm{{*}^{2}} $

$ =2.4\times 10^{5}gcm{{}^{2}} $
